What Is a P&C Core Platform?
A P&C core platform comprises the mission-critical software engines that record, calculate, and process carrier transactions across six operational pillars: Policy Administration, Claims Adjudication, Premium Billing, Underwriting Workbenches, Rating/Pricing Engines, and Integration APIs. The platform serves as the single source of truth for policyholder liabilities, earned premium recognition, reserve allocations, and reinsurance cessions.
| Component | Function |
|---|---|
| Policy Administration System (PAS) | Manages the full policy lifecycle: quoting, binding, issuance, endorsements, renewals, cancellations |
| Claims Management System | Handles first notice of loss (FNOL), investigation, adjudication, reserves management, settlement |
| Billing Platform | Manages premium billing, payment processing, commission accounting, receivables |
| Underwriting Workbench | Supports risk evaluation, data enrichment, and decision-making workflows |
| Rating Engine | Calculates premiums based on risk factors, regulatory rules, and pricing models |
| Integration Layer (APIs) | Connects core modules with external systems, data providers, and distribution channels |

Evolution of P&C Insurance Core Systems
The Mainframe Era (1970s to 2004)
First-generation insurance core systems relied on mainframe architectures programmed in COBOL or Fortran, optimized for nighttime batch processing. An estimated 35% to 40% of North American policy administration systems remain tied to legacy mainframe code bases as of 2026.
The On-Premise COTS Era (2005 to 2018)
Commercial-off-the-shelf (COTS) software packages replaced custom-coded mainframes with vendor-supported applications (Guidewire, Duck Creek, Sapiens). Modernization during this period involved multi-year on-premise deployments with total implementation costs ranging from USD 50 million to USD 300 million for enterprise carriers.
The Cloud-Native SaaS Era (2019 to Present)
Current architecture centers on cloud-native, microservices-based SaaS platforms. Over 80% of new core selections specify cloud deployment. Modern platforms utilize microservices, API-first integrations (MACH architecture), and embedded event streaming to enable sub-second rating and real-time claims routing.
Key Components of Modern P&C Core Platforms
When evaluating the top p&c insurance core systems platforms comparison, buyers prioritize six functional modules that define a modern core platform:
Policy Administration Systems
Modern PAS solutions support multi-line, multi-jurisdiction product configuration with real-time rating and rules engines. Leading carriers using modern platforms achieve straight-through processing rates of 70 to 85 percent for standard personal lines policies.
Claims Management Systems
Claims represent the single largest expense category for P&C insurers. Modern claims management systems integrate AI-powered triage (90 to 95 percent accuracy at leading carriers), computer vision for damage assessment, and automated settlement workflows. Digital claims filing reached approximately 55 to 60 percent of new claims at top US carriers in 2024, up from 35 percent in 2021, and average auto claims processing time has fallen from around 30 days in 2018 to 15-20 days among digitally mature carriers.
Billing and Payments
Modern billing platforms support flexible installment schedules, automated commission reconciliations, and real-time digital payment processing, achieving 85% to 95% automated payment matching across standard personal and commercial accounts.
Analytics, AI, and Fraud Detection
According to the Coalition against insurance fraud (CAIF), fraud accounts for an estimated $308.6 billion in losses each year in the United States alone, of which $90-122 billion comes from Property & Casualty (P&C). Real-time risk scoring engines integrated at FNOL detect 40% to 60% more fraudulent filings than legacy rule-based triggers.

Key Risk Factors and Migration Challenges
Implementation Complexity and Capital Outlay
Core platform replacements represent high-friction capital expenditures, averaging 18 to 36 months in duration and USD 50 million to USD 300 million in total cost for Tier-1 carriers. Industry historical data indicates that approximately 70% of single-phase “big bang” core replacements exceed budget or fail to meet initial operational metrics, driving carriers to adopt phased, line-of-business migration frameworks.
Data Migration and Legacy Extraction Risk
Extracting, normalizing, and ingesting decades of policy history, loss records, and billing data from legacy mainframes to cloud databases represents up to 40% of total implementation budgets. Fifty percent of carrier IT executives identify legacy data schema incompatibilities as the primary bottleneck in platform deployment.
Cybersecurity Exposure and Regulatory Risk
Insurance sector cyber security incidents increased by 38% between 2022 and 2024 (IBM Security X-Force). Over 92% of CIOs rate cloud security controls as a primary filter during core selection. Under the EU DORA framework, regulators now exercise direct supervision over cloud core platform providers as critical ICT third-party vendors.
COBOL Engineering Deficit
Seventy-two percent of insurance technology executives report talent shortages across cloud architecture and data engineering. With roughly 50% of current legacy mainframe engineering staff reaching retirement age by 2030, maintaining custom legacy code bases is incurring escalating labor premiums.

AI in Claims
Automated triage AI models sort and route incoming claims with 90-95% accuracy. Document processing sees 50-70% reduction in manual data entry time. Computer vision damage assessment operates within 5% of adjuster accuracy. Claims leakage reduction through AI-driven detection saves an estimated 3-5% of total claims costs. Generative AI summaries reduce adjuster administrative time by 25-40%.
AI in Underwriting and Fraud Detection
Machine learning risk-scoring models analyzing hundreds of data points deliver 20-30 percent improvement in loss ratio accuracy, and 40-50 percent of personal lines submissions are handled without human intervention at leading carriers. AI-powered fraud detection identifies 40-60 percent more fraudulent claims than rule-based systems; Shift Technology alone processes over 400 million claims globally.
Regulatory Watch: AI Governance
As of early 2026, 23-26+ US states and Washington, D.C. have adopted some form of the NAIC Model Bulletin on AI, requiring carriers to maintain written AI governance programs, document model testing, and conduct third-party AI vendor due diligence. Over 90% of insurers report having regularly revised AI governance policies, but fewer than 30% believe that is enough to keep pace with shifting regulatory demands.
Enterprise Modernization Case Studies
Liberty Mutual: Serverless Financial Architecture
Liberty Mutual migrated its core financial transaction engine to an AWS serverless architecture. The system processes over 100 million monthly financial transactions at an execution cost of $0.00006 per transaction, reducing microservice deployment timelines from 12 months to 3 months.
Zurich Insurance Group: Global Cloud Foundation
Zurich Insurance Group migrated 1,000 application workloads to AWS under its Global Cloud Foundation program, achieving a 97% data center reduction across Zurich North America and reducing environment provisioning times from 48 hours to 2 hours.
State Farm: Mainframe Migration & DevOps
State Farm modernized 800 legacy applications using AWS Mainframe Modernization and VMware Tanzu, compressing deployment cycles from multi-week release windows to automated daily releases.
USAA: Data Warehousing Optimization
USAA unified its financial reporting infrastructure on Snowflake and Oracle Cloud, achieving a 51% reduction in monthly book-closing cycle times and eliminating 27% of manual audit controls.

AI Evolution: Three Phases
- Assistive AI (2024-2026): Generative AI tools that summarize documents, draft communications, and recommend actions for human review
- Co-pilot AI (2026-2028): AI systems that actively collaborate with underwriters and adjusters, making preliminary decisions subject to human oversight
- Autonomous AI (2028-2035): Agentic AI systems making binding decisions for standard risks and routine claims without human intervention
